检查数据库服务端是否已启动,网络连接是否正常,监听程序配置是否正确
时间: 2024-03-27 15:35:37 浏览: 18
要检查数据库服务端是否已启动,网络连接是否正常,监听程序配置是否正确,可以尝试以下步骤:
1. 检查数据库服务端是否已启动:可以通过lsnrctl status命令检查数据库服务端是否已启动,如果未启动,可以通过sqlplus / as sysdba和startup命令启动。
2. 检查网络连接是否正常:可以通过ping命令或telnet命令检查客户端和服务端之间的网络连接是否正常。例如,可以使用以下命令测试客户端是否可以连接到服务端的1521端口:
```
telnet <服务端IP地址> 1521
```
如果连接成功,则表示网络连接正常;如果连接失败,则可能是网络连接出现问题。
3. 检查监听程序配置是否正确:可以通过lsnrctl status命令检查监听程序是否已正确配置。如果监听程序未正确配置,则可能导致客户端无法连接到数据库服务端。可以使用以下命令查看监听程序的配置:
```
lsnrctl status
```
如果监听程序未正确配置,则可以通过编辑listener.ora文件或使用netca工具重新配置监听程序。
相关问题
检查数据库服务端是否已启动
要检查数据库服务端是否已启动,可以尝试以下步骤:
1. 打开命令提示符或终端窗口。
2. 输入以下命令检查数据库服务端是否已启动:
```
lsnrctl status
```
如果输出类似以下内容,则表示数据库服务端已启动:
```
Service "ORCL" has 1 instance(s).
Instance "ORCL", status READY, has 1 handler(s) for this service...
```
如果输出类似以下内容,则表示数据库服务端未启动:
```
TNS-12541: TNS:no listener
```
此时需要启动数据库服务端。
3. 如果数据库服务端未启动,可以通过以下命令启动:
```
sqlplus / as sysdba
startup
```
这将启动Oracle数据库服务端。
确认ceph服务端是否正常启动,并且配置正确;
要确认 Ceph 服务端是否正常启动并且配置正确,您可以执行以下步骤:
1. 检查 Ceph 服务端进程是否正在运行。您可以使用以下命令检查:
```
ps -ef | grep ceph
```
如果 Ceph 进程在运行,则会看到相关的进程信息。
2. 检查 Ceph 配置文件。您可以使用以下命令检查 Ceph 配置文件:
```
sudo ceph -s
```
如果配置文件无误,则应该会显示 Ceph 集群的状态信息。
3. 检查 Ceph 存储池。您可以使用以下命令检查 Ceph 存储池:
```
sudo rados lspools
```
如果存储池存在,则应该会列出所有的存储池名称。
如果以上步骤都没有问题,那么 Ceph 服务端应该已经正常启动并且配置正确。如果您仍然遇到问题,可以查看 Ceph 的日志文件以获取更多信息。